"Wow, am I glad I stayed here! I cannot say enough about the hospitality of the owners. My experience here would’ve been fine anyway, but when I came out in the morning and my car wouldn’t start, Stephanie bent over backwards to help me out—letting me borrow tools, trying to give me a jump, and even giving me a ride into town and back (turned out to be just a dead battery—I greatly appreciate not having to walk a mile or more to the auto parts store lugging the battery in mid 90s heat). I didn’t see this place initially when searching for hotels in Clayton, but noticed it driving into town. Turns out they had the lowest rate in town. The room itself was no-frills, but plenty comfortable. The bed was nice and firm. A/C ran ice cold all night, and provided enough white noise to cover up any loud noises from the highway or other guests loading up and leaving in the morning. When I discovered there wasn’t a mini-fridge (I forgot to ask when I checked in), they offered to put my ice packs in their freezer in the office. There was an old musty/smoky smell in the room (nothing recent, it was a non-smoking room but smelled like it had been smoked in quite a bit many years ago), but it dissipated quickly once I turned the air on. Nothing unusual for an older hotel. If you’re looking for an inexpensive, no-frills place to crash, this will do the trick. And knowing how ownership treated me, I would recommend it to anyone. I doubt I would’ve been helped out like I was had I stayed somewhere else. If I could give more than 5 stars I would!"
